Everything has been confirmed as of yesterday! We are also hiring the services of a private guide for the four of us in Rome and in Florence (union rules in Italy don't allow driver/guides to lead tours away from their vehicle). Because we also booked the driver and car, there is a discount for the guide as well. This discount reduces the cost of the guide from 65 Euro per hour to 50 Euro per hour, a savings of 120 Euro for both tours.

 

Total cost is 1,400 Euro for both tours with guide, about $1,850. This compares to the $1,544 it would cost us to take the ship's bus tours that take 40+ people to the same, but not all, places as the RIL tours. More expensive, but more personalized, more efficient, and completely flexible. Plus, we'll be able to climb to the top of the Leaning Tower of Pisa, which is on my "bucket list", and the ship's tour does not.

If you create a tour with RIL, they will put it on their site for others to see from your ship. You may get people that are not on Cruise Critic but other people from the ship, who happen to be looking for tours. Take a look at: www.romeinlimotoursharing.com
